Why Steel Dump Trucks Dominate Snow Removal

An in-depth look at the commercial and industrial landscape of winter fleet operations

When winter storms descend on cities, highways, airports, and industrial zones, one machine consistently proves indispensable: the steel dump truck. Unlike plastic-lined or composite-body alternatives, steel-bodied dump trucks offer a unique combination of structural integrity, thermal resistance, and raw payload capacity that makes them the preferred platform for snow removal operations worldwide.

The Commercial & Industrial Landscape of Steel Dump Trucks in Snow Removal

Snow removal is no longer a purely municipal concern. Today, it spans a vast commercial ecosystem involving highway authorities, airport operators, logistics park managers, mining companies, and real estate developers. The steel dump truck sits at the center of this ecosystem, serving as the primary tool for collecting, transporting, and depositing large volumes of snow away from operational areas.

In North America and Northern Europe — regions with the most mature snow removal markets — municipal contracts for heavy dump trucks run into the billions of dollars annually. In emerging markets across Central Asia, Russia, and parts of South America, rapid urbanization is creating new demand for reliable, cost-effective winter fleet vehicles.

Chinese manufacturers such as Sinotruk HOWO and Shacman have captured significant market share globally by offering steel dump trucks that combine high payload ratings (often 20–40 tonnes), robust powertrain options (371HP–420HP), and competitive pricing — making professional-grade snow removal accessible to a much wider range of operators.

Steel Body Advantages for Winter Operations

The choice of steel over alternative materials is not accidental. In snow removal, dump truck bodies face extreme conditions: repeated freeze-thaw cycles, contact with corrosive road salt, abrasion from plowed ice and gravel, and the thermal shock of loading hot exhaust-warmed snow onto a cold body. Steel — particularly high-strength, wear-resistant grades — handles all of these stresses better than any other commercially viable material.

  • High tensile strength: Resists deformation under heavy, compacted snow loads
  • Weldability: Easier field repairs in remote or cold-weather environments
  • Thermal mass: Helps prevent snow from freezing and sticking to the body during transport
  • Corrosion treatment options: Modern anti-rust coatings and galvanized liners extend service life even in salt-heavy environments
  • Cost-effectiveness: Lower acquisition and repair cost compared to specialty alloy bodies

Development Trends Shaping the Snow Removal Truck Market

The steel dump truck industry is undergoing a significant transformation driven by technology, regulation, and shifting operational demands. Understanding these trends is essential for fleet managers, procurement officers, and municipal planners making long-term investment decisions.

Electrification & Hybrid Powertrains

While full electrification of heavy dump trucks remains a medium-term goal, hybrid systems are already entering snow removal fleets in Scandinavia and Canada. Electric motors provide instant torque — ideal for the stop-start nature of urban snow clearing — while diesel range extenders maintain operational flexibility in remote areas.

Modular Body Systems

Increasingly, operators are specifying dump trucks with modular body attachments — allowing the same steel chassis to be fitted with snow plow mounts, spreader hoppers, or standard dump bodies depending on seasonal requirements. This multi-role capability dramatically improves asset utilization rates.

🛠

Advanced Anti-Corrosion Technology

Salt-induced corrosion is the primary cause of premature dump body failure in snow removal applications. New-generation hot-dip galvanizing, epoxy primer systems, and polyurethane topcoats are extending steel body service life to 12–15 years even in high-salt environments.

Deep Application Scenarios

Where steel dump trucks deliver the most critical snow removal value

Airport Runway & Taxiway Clearance

Airports operate under zero-tolerance snow accumulation policies. Steel dump trucks — often running in coordinated convoys — collect snow pushed by runway plows and transport it to designated melt areas. The high payload capacity of 6×4 and 8×4 configurations reduces the number of haul cycles required, minimizing airfield disruption. Tight turnaround times demand rapid hydraulic tipping, a standard feature on HOWO TX and NX platforms.

The Economic Case for Steel Dump Trucks in Snow Removal Fleets

For fleet managers evaluating total cost of ownership (TCO), steel dump trucks represent a compelling proposition in snow removal applications. The combination of low acquisition cost, high durability, and broad parts availability — particularly for Chinese-manufactured platforms — delivers TCO advantages that are difficult to match with European or North American alternatives.

A typical HOWO 6×4 steel dump truck deployed in snow removal operations can expect a service life of 10–15 years with proper maintenance. When amortized over this period, the annual capital cost per tonne of snow moved is significantly lower than competing platforms. Fuel efficiency improvements in the latest HOWO TX and NX series — featuring optimized combustion chambers and predictive power control — further reduce operational costs.

Spare parts availability is another critical TCO factor. Sinotruk and Shacman have established extensive global parts networks, ensuring that even trucks operating in remote regions can be maintained with minimal downtime. This is particularly valuable in snow removal operations, where equipment downtime during a storm event can have serious safety and economic consequences.
